Country Captain Chicken
Ready In: 90 Minutes
Prep Time: 30 Minutes
Cook Time: 50 Minutes
Serves 4
DIRECTIONS
In a skillet, sauté the bacon until crisp. Then remove, and pat dry on paper towels. Have the bacon fat hot in the pan and brown the chicken pieces quickly, a few at a time, turning and allowing room between the pieces. Set the browned pieces aside and continue until all are browned. Drain all but 2 tablespoons of fat from the pan. Add the pepper, onion, garlic, and celery, and sauté for 5 minutes. Coarsely chop the tomatoes and add to the pan with a little of their juice and the orange juice. Season with curry powder and thyme. Bring to a boil, reduce the heat, and simmer for 5 minutes. Put the chicken pieces back into the pan and spoon the sauce over them. Cover and simmer for 30 minutes. Serve with rice and garnish with the raisins, almonds, and parsley.
